Compartir a través de


IClassificationTypeRegistryService (Interfaz)

El servicio que mantiene la colección de todos los tipos de clasificación conocidos.

Espacio de nombres:  Microsoft.VisualStudio.Text.Classification
Ensamblado:  Microsoft.VisualStudio.Text.Logic (en Microsoft.VisualStudio.Text.Logic.dll)

Sintaxis

'Declaración
Public Interface IClassificationTypeRegistryService
public interface IClassificationTypeRegistryService
public interface class IClassificationTypeRegistryService
type IClassificationTypeRegistryService =  interface end
public interface IClassificationTypeRegistryService

El tipo IClassificationTypeRegistryService expone los siguientes miembros.

Métodos

  Nombre Descripción
Método público CreateClassificationType Inicializa una nueva instancia de IClassificationType y la agrega al Registro.
Método público CreateTransientClassificationType(array<IClassificationType[]) Crea un objeto IClassificationType que solo se mantiene durante esta sesión.
Método público CreateTransientClassificationType(IEnumerable<IClassificationType>) Crea IClassificationType que conserva únicamente para la duración de esta sesión.
Método público GetClassificationType obtiene el objeto de IClassificationType identificado por el tipo especificado.

Arriba

Comentarios

Esto es una parte MEF, y debe ser importada como sigue:

[Import] IClassificationTypeRegistryService registry = null;

Para obtener más información sobre la clasificación, vea la sección “tipos de Clasificación que extienden y Clasificación da formato” en Puntos de extensión del editor.

Vea también

Referencia

Microsoft.VisualStudio.Text.Classification (Espacio de nombres)